Engine Oil and Filter
Engine oil quality is the chief factor
affecting engine service life. Change the
engine oil as specified in the maintenance
schedule, (page 50)
NOTE:
Change the engine oil with the engine
warm and the motorcycle on its center
stand to assure complete and rapid
draining.
(1) Oil drain plug (2) Scaling washer
CAUTION:
To prevent oil leaks and filter damage,
never support the engine on the oil
filter.
1. To drain the oil, remove the oil filler
cap, crankcase drain plug (1) and
sealing washer (2).
2. Remove the oil filter (3) with a filter
wrench and let the remaining oil drain
out. Discard the oil filter.
3. Check that the new oil filter 0 - ring is
in good condition.

Honda NT650 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Displacement647 cc
Bore x Stroke79.0 mm x 66.0 mm
Compression Ratio10.0:1
Transmission5-speed
Rear BrakesSingle 240mm disc with single-piston caliper
Front Tire120/70-17
Rear Tire150/70-17
Seat Height800 mm (31.5 inches)
Final DriveChain
Fuel Capacity19 liters (5.0 US gallons)
Wheelbase1, 460 mm (57.5 inches)
Engine TypeLiquid-cooled, 4-stroke, SOHC, V-twin
Fuel SystemCarburetor (2x 36mm Keihin CV)
Front Suspension41 mm telescopic fork
Rear SuspensionPro-Link single shock
Front BrakesDual 296mm discs with 2-piston calipers
